78 years ago today:
#OTD in 1942, US Army Air Force aircraft launched their first raid from a new base on Adak island in Alaska which had started construction only 13 days earlier! In the raid, 12 B-24 Liberators, 14 P-38 Lightnings, and 14 P-39 Airacobras attacked Japanese forces at Kiska island, sinking two Japanese ships, damaging three more, and destroying three midget submarines, several buildings, and 12 Japanese floatplane fighters.
